All aboard the BICIBUS – along with your bike!

 

Free shuttle transfer for cyclists from 22 June to 14 September 2025

This summer has a lot in store for cyclists in the Vipava Valley: Plan a cross-border Sunday trip to discover secrets of the border region, explore parts of the Alpina–Mediterranean Cycling Route connecting Friuli and western Slovenia, or escape the heat of the Vipava Valley and enjoy a relaxed ride across the cool, forested Trnovo Plateau. The BICIBUS runs free of charge for you and your bike – all summer long!

From the Vipava Valley to Predmeja and back

During your stay in the Vipava Valley, you’ll find countless opportunities for cycling, whether you’re pedalling across the valley or its friendly, vineyard-covered hills. On warm, sunny days, you can escape the heat by heading up to forested trails shaded by sprawling woodland. And this year, a bike shuttle bus makes it even easier to enjoy a relaxing cycling tour across the cool Trnovo Plateau. Discover how, even at the height of summer, the plateau offers perfect conditions for a relaxed and scenic ride.

Every Thursday and Sunday between 22 June and 14 September 2025, the BICIBUS offers free shuttle rides twice a day between the Vipava Valley and Predmeja.

The BICIBUS departs from the main bus station in Ajdovščina, arrives in Vipava and stops at the Škofijska gimnazija, then continues to Črniče, with stops at the bus stop and Camp David, before bringing passengers and their bikes to the final stop in Predmeja. On the return journey, the shuttle bus also stops in Lokavec, at the Porka Eva pizzeria, where it picks up cyclists who rode down into the valley.

No reservations are required; transport is available until all seats are taken.

From Ajdovščina to Cividale and back – or the other way around

Take advantage of a cross-border cycling opportunity and explore places that, despite being nearby, you may not have yet visited. Visit the picturesque Friulian town of Cividale and ride across the famous Ponte del Diavolo. In Ajdovščina, a town built on the foundations of the former Roman fort Castra, uncover the town’s remarkably well-preserved remains and captivating tales from late antiquity. Along the way, don’t forget to visit Nova Gorica, which together with the Italian Gorizia forms a unique European twin city that will be jointly hosting the European Capital of Culture in 2025. Hop on the BICIBUS—your bike in tow—and kick off an unforgettable adventure.

Every Sunday from 22 June to 14 September 2025, the BICIBUS offers free rides twice per day on the route between Ajdovščina and Cividale, in both directions.

You can also use the BICIBUS cross-border bike shuttle bus to explore a leg of the Alpina-Mediterranean Cycle Route connecting the Friuli region with western Slovenia. Find the route map here.

Another option is to take the train to Nova Gorica and board the BICIBUS from there. By combining these two eco-friendly modes of transport, you’ll also help keep our environment clean and unspoilt.

No reservations are required; transport is available until all seats are taken.
